Discussion on: Demystifying NLP concepts in simple words—101

Can you present the libraries that are considered mature enough on each parts ?
Last time i checked (1-2 years ago) it was difficult to visualize the steps needed to produce a TTS that was a decent voice on a local machine ie. without using a not-free web service.
What i want to achieve is taking enough samples from a celebrity voice and produce the data required to make it enough credible to speak notifications.
The open source software i found are either producing some very un-natural voice or too cryptic on what data they need and how to produce it.
Thanks :)